(PRESS RELEASE) The Accredited Gemologists Association ( AGA) invites gemologists, jewelry professionals, and gem enthusiasts alike to register for “Diamonds from Mine to Market,” a half-day Virtual Gemological Education Conference dedicated entirely to the fascinating world of diamonds. The live event will take place on Tuesday, June 24, 2025, from 9:00 AM to 12:00 PM (PDT).
This engaging virtual conference will feature leading experts from De Beers, GIA, and Gemworld International, offering timely insights and deep dives into key topics such as:
- Advances in diamond mining and recovery technologies, presented by Pamela Cook-Ellemers, Principal Mineral Resource Manager, De Beers Group
- The latest developments in fancy shape cut grading presented by Dr. James Conant and Amanda Hawkes from the GIA-AGS collaboration team
- The growing role of branding in the diamond market, presented by Stuart Robertson, President of Gemworld International
Participants will gain a deeper understanding of how innovation and expertise are shaping the journey of diamonds—from their origins beneath the earth to their presentation in the marketplace.
“This is an exciting opportunity to deliver current, insightful, and objective gemological education,” said AGA President Teri Brossmer. “AGA is proud to offer a platform that brings together industry leaders and delivers value to our members and the global gemological community.”
